As a renowned expert in the field of graphic arts, M.C. Escher embarked on his first trip to Italy during the 1920s and ultimately made Rome his home for 12 years until 1935. This period in Rome greatly influenced his later work, which focused on lithographs, etchings, and depictions of landscapes, architecture, and the fascinating sights of ancient and Baroque Rome. Escher's exploration of this captivating city often took place at night, illuminated only by the soft glow of lantern light.

Explore the lengthy career of Escher with this comprehensive volume that showcases over 300 of his works, including famous pieces like Hand with Reflecting Sphere and Bond of Union. Released in conjunction with an exhibition at Palazzo Bonaparte in Rome, this book also delves into his early designs and lesser-known 12 Roman Nocturnes series. Escher's unique and captivating art has captured the hearts of not only art enthusiasts, but also those with an interest in mathematics, geometry, science, design, and graphics. Considered a visionary in his own right, his work appeals to diverse audiences and solidifies his place in the history of art.

About the Artist

M. C. Escher

Maurits Cornelis Escher (1898 – 1972) was a Dutch graphic artist who made woodcuts, lithographs, and mezzotints, many of which were inspired by mathematics. Despite wide popular interest, for most of his life Escher was neglected in the art world, even in his native Netherlands. He was 70 before a retrospective exhibition was held. In the late twentieth century, he became more widely appreciated, and in the twenty-first century he has been celebrated in exhibitions around the world.

About the Publisher

Artbook | D.A.P.

Artbook | Distributed Art Publishers, Inc. is America’s premier source for books on twentieth and twenty-first century art, photography, design and aesthetic culture. Founded in 1990 in downtown New York at a time when fine and sometimes esoteric international art books had a difficult time making their way into the wider American marketplace, over the past three decades D.A.P. has grown into a major international distributor of books, special editions and rare publications from an array of the world’s most respected publishers, museums and cultural institutions.
